The fastest, smallest, most secure self-hostable PDF REST API. A stateless
single-shot HTTP service that wraps the pdf_oxide
Rust engine: send a PDF, get a result back, nothing is kept.

curl -s -F file=@invoice.pdf http://localhost:8080/v1/extract/text- Self-hosted & private. PDFs with confidential or personal data never
leave your infrastructure. No database, no temp files held between requests,
no telemetry. Results are sent
Cache-Control: no-store. - Tiny & hardened. A single static Rust binary in a distroless, non-root, read-only-rootfs container (~8–16 MB).
- Built for automation. A clean REST + JSON contract (OpenAPI 3.1) that drops straight into n8n, Dify, and any HTTP-capable workflow tool.
- Japanese / CJK form-fill as a first-class feature — values are passed through verbatim as UTF-8.
| Family | Endpoints |
|---|---|
| Extraction | text, markdown, html |
| Forms | fields (introspect), fill |
| Document ops | merge, split, metadata, page-info |
| Pipeline | pipeline (chain ops in one request) |
